Youth Critical After Brutal Knife Attack by Friend in Bhadrak

A shocking incident unfolded in Bhadrak when a college student lured his friend away, assaulted him with a knife, and robbed him of valuables.


Rajiv Lochan Pani, a Plus Two student of Jhadeswar College in Balasore, went missing Monday evening after leaving home near Motel Chhak. His parents grew anxious when he failed to return by 9 p.m., and his phone remained switched off.

On Tuesday morning, locals discovered Rajiv unconscious and bleeding near the Nalanga canal, five kilometres from Bhadrak. He sustained severe injuries to his head, chest, back, stomach, and face, requiring more than sixty stitches. Doctors described his condition as critical and referred him to Cuttack for advanced treatment.

Rajiv later revealed that his friend Abhishek Nayak, a student of Asurali Best Engineering College, had taken him on his bike. Near the Nalanga canal, Abhishek suddenly attacked him with a knife, ignoring Rajiv’s pleas for mercy. He snatched Rajiv’s gold bracelet, mobile phone, and cash before fleeing, leaving him bleeding by the roadside.

Police registered a case at Bhadrak Rural Station and launched a search for Abhishek. The incident has shocked residents, highlighting the betrayal of trust between friends.
